Output 01c8cdf1d040efd080f571a7d03a379d43c131d6488eaa7a6149fa77dbcdcac2:0

value
13624683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36ec9493d693cc58cd7773e2ce3b84fb5f83267b OP_EQUAL
address
36hRpo6m4g3dasZwAbqtyJP3abUs5V5MLf
transaction
01c8cdf1d040efd080f571a7d03a379d43c131d6488eaa7a6149fa77dbcdcac2
confirmations
389358
spent
true